Roofing repairs vary based on a few key factors. The specific material on your roof, such as asphalt shingles versus metal, plays a significant role. We also look at the total square footage of the damaged area, how easily accessible the roof is, and whether there is hidden water damage underneath the surface. Homeowners insurance in Nashville might cover roof repairs if the damage stems from a sudden event, like a severe storm or falling debris. Typical wear and tear, or damage from prolonged neglect, is usually not covered. A professional can help you assess your specific situation for potential claims.
